1 The Samuel H. Kress Foundation and AAMC Foundation Affiliated Fellowship at the American Academy in Rome Purpose and Background The Association of Art Museum Curators (AAMC) Foundation and the American Academy in Rome (AAR) and are pleased to announce the fourth year of The Samuel H. Kress Foundation and AAMC Foundation Affiliated Fellowship at the American Academy in Rome. The program is intended to honor exceptional curatorial vision and help curators advance deserving projects. The purpose of the award is to provide essential funding for curators to develop projects that require research in Italy. While the AAR is the physical base for the month, the project may be on a subject that is not limited to research in Rome only. Thus, the research need not be Rome-specific. The rich content of libraries and archives in Rome are a portal to conducting work on myriad Italian topics from all arts disciplines and time periods. Day trips or an occasional overnight trip to other cities are permissible given the proximity of so many places to Rome by train: Florence, Milan, Naples, or other places that might have artworks or documents key to a specific project. The AAMC & AAMC Foundation celebrate the curatorial narrative by being a voice for all art curators regardless of field, experience level, and institutional type, and we provide professional development, leadership skills, and direct connections for all art curators working in the not-forprofit sector. All of our programming and overall efforts shall strive to be representative of diversity: across self-identifications (by nation, gender, creed, race), fields of expertise, types of institutional mission, and regional position of participants. Description The Affiliated Fellowship is a four-week appointment at the AAR, which includes housing in a single room; six lunches and five dinners a week and access to residence hall kitchens; $1,500 in airfare; and a $2,000 stipend. Affiliated Fellows have access to all the AAR facilities (including 24-hour a day, seven days a week access to the library) and all activities that occur at the Academy, such as concerts, exhibitions, conferences, lectures, and tours. Due to space limitations the AAR is unable to accommodate the spouses/partners or children of Affiliated Fellows. If desired, the Affiliated Fellow may schedule a talk about his or her project at the AAR during the Fellowship period. About the AAMC & AAMC Foundation Founded in 2001, the Association of Art Museum Curators (AAMC) has over 1,300 members from over 400 institutions around the globe. In the ever-changing visual art community, AAMC & AAMC Foundation are the voice for all art curators working in the non-profit sector regardless of field, experience level, and institutional type. We ensure that the curatorial perspective on art, museums, and educational issues is actively communicated to the public, media, and museum profession. For more information, visit artcurators.org.

2 About the Samuel H. Kress Foundation The mission of the Samuel H. Kress Foundation (est. 1929) is to sustain and carry out the original vision of founder, Samuel H. Kress ( ). The Kress Foundation supports the work of individuals and institutions engaged with appreciation, interpretation, preservation, study and teaching of the history of European art and architecture from antiquity to the dawn of the modern era. About the American Academy in Rome Founded in 1894, the American Academy in Rome is a leading international center for independent studies and advanced research in the arts and humanities. Each year, following a national juried competition, the Rome Prize is awarded to approximately 30 Americans working in Ancient, Medieval, Renaissance and Early Modern, and Modern Italian Studies, and Architecture, Landscape Architecture, Design, Historic Preservation and Conservation, Literature, Musical Composition, and Visual Arts. The annual application deadline for the Rome Prize is November 1. To learn more, please visit: Eligibility Open to all AAMC individual members in good standing. Research can be exhibition related or for written scholarly work, but should not be in conjunction with completing a dissertation. Applicant is required to list preferred period of residency, indicating a first and second choice. A letter of support is required from the institution s director, project director and/or host of project. Please see Recommendation Form for more information. Priority will be given to those without funds to support research travel. Reporting and Other Requirements The curator and institution (if applicable) agree to: Acknowledge the Fellowship in publicity materials and news releases related to the project. Submit a final written report to the AAMC and AAR within one month of the Fellowship summarizing the goals, activities, and results of the support. Complete a questionnaire provided by the AAR. Application Procedure Please submit IN ONE the following materials, as one pdf (letter of receommendation may be a separate attachment) to programs@artcurators.org: Completed application form (below). Full description of the project: Limited to 1,000 1,500 words MAXIMUM, 2 page limit. Statement of interest in the Fellowship, including why the research can only be done in Italy, with a base in Rome.

3 List of archives, institutions, sites, and libraries that will be utilized during your research. Please be realistic and take into consideration the limitations that permission for access, open hours, and other factors could have on your research schedule. Descriptive timeline with proposed activities that the Fellowship will make possible. Letter of support from institution director, project director and/or host of project that confirms the viability of the project and ability of the applicant to be in Rome for four continuous weeks. Please see the Recommendation Form for guidelines. List of other sources of funding that you have sought, including from your own institution, noting if the funding was awarded or not. Curriculum vitae of the curator. If related to the proposed project, web links to exhibitions, publications, or research. PLEASE NOTE: NO additional materials will be accepted or reviewed in consideration of this Fellowship. Please do not send catalogues or volumes of press materials. Deadline and Notification Please the completed application to Receipt of application will be confirmed by within ten days. All materials must be RECEIVED in the AAMC office by January 9, Notification of Fellowship Award will be made in January/February 2017.
